Warum sollte ich @ Url.Content ("~ / blah-blah-blah") verwenden?

Ich kann die Vorteile, die ich daraus ziehen kann, nicht verstehenUrl.Content() Methode in ASP.NET MVC. Zum Beispiel sehen Siesrc='@Url.Content("~/Contents/Scripts/jQuery.js")'. Warum sollte ich es benutzen? Welche Gründe könnten dafür sprechen? Welche Vorteile, Vorteile, etc. gegenüber der Verwendung von einfachen alten Referenzen gefallensrc='/scripts/jquery.js?

Aktualisieren: Anhand der Antworten würde ich gerne wissen, ob es einen anderen Grund für die Verwendung gibt als die Bearbeitung virtueller Ordner. Weil ich nicht gesehen habe, wie oft virtuelle Anwendungen verwendet werden (was natürlich nicht bedeutet, dass sie nicht so oft verwendet wurden).

Antworten auf die Frage(3)

Ihre Antwort auf die Frage